Customer Relationship Management (CRM) Software
CRM software is the backbone of any successful sales operation. These platforms allow you to centralize customer data, track interactions, and manage relationships more effectively. With CRM software, you can easily track leads through the sales funnel, prioritize follow-ups, and personalize your communications for maximum impact.
Email Automation Platforms
Email automation platforms are another essential tool for streamlining your sales process. These platforms allow you to automate repetitive tasks such as sending follow-up emails, nurturing leads, and scheduling meetings. By automating these tasks, you can free up valuable time to focus on high-value activities such as building relationships with prospects and closing deals.
Sales Enablement Tools
Sales enablement tools are designed to empower your sales team with the resources they need to succeed. These tools can include everything from content management systems to sales training platforms. By providing your team with easy access to relevant content, training materials, and resources, you can ensure that they have the tools they need to close more deals and drive revenue.
Analytics and Reporting Tools
Data-driven decision-making is essential for sales success, which is where analytics and reporting tools come in. These tools allow you to track key metrics such as lead conversion rates, sales pipeline velocity, and revenue forecasts. By analyzing this data, you can identify trends, uncover insights, and make informed decisions to drive growth.
